Product Description:
Used in organic semiconductor materials due to its electron-deficient nature and planar conjugated structure. It serves as a key building block in the synthesis of high-performance organic field-effect transistors (OFETs) and donor-acceptor copolymers for organic photovoltaics (OPVs). Its strong intermolecular interactions enhance charge carrier mobility in thin-film devices. Also employed in the development of conductive polymers and small-molecule semiconductors for flexible electronics and printed circuits.
